I would not boil her! You are a customiser, you must have a scalpel or exacto knife laying around. Slide that under the edge of the wig. Or if you'd rather, a flathead screwdriver would work too. Start at the back though to be safe. It really isn't hard to get wigs off. The glue isn't usually very secure and once started typically pulls right off without too much effort.
